Household of Geesa - Geske Wurtz

She is married to Gerdcke - Gotfried - Godike Cordes.

They got married on January 26, 1631 at Wesuwe, Haren (Ems), Landkreis Emsland, Lower Saxony, Germany, she was 26 years old.Source 3

Witness: Joanni Einspanier aus Wesuwe J?? Lübbers aus Bersede

Child(ren):

  1. Hermannus Wurtz  1639-???? 
  2. Geseke - Gebbeke Wurtz  1640-???? 
  3. Johan Wurtz  1640-????
